CARIFESTA XV

The Hon Owen K Darrell, JP MP, Minister of Tourism & Transport, Culture & Sport attended CARIFESTA XV in Bridgetown, Barbados to celebrate Bermuda's participation. The Bermuda Delegation was represented by 18 creatives across dance, music, visual arts, film and literature. The Minister was accompanied by technical officers from the Department of Culture. 

Bermuda Night at Golden Square Freedom Park featured performances by the delegation presenting the Bermuda story.

Seatrade Cruise Global 2025

The Hon Owen Darrell, Minister of Tourism & Transport, Culture & Sport, attended a cruise industry conference in Maimi Florida in a bid to boost cruise traffic to the island. 

Seatrade Cruise Global 2025 had more than 11, 000 attendees from 120 countries and allowed Bermuda to have conversations that shape the future of the cruise industry. The three-day summit is a chance to network and build meaningful connections with cruise lines.
